Lucy Callahan was struck by lightning. She doesn't remember it, but it changed her life forever. The zap gave her genius-level math skills, and ever since, Lucy has been homeschooled. Now, at 12 years old, she's technically ready for college. She just has to pass 1 more test—middle school!
Lucy's grandma insists: Go to middle school for 1 year. Make 1 friend. Join 1 activity. And read 1 book (that's not a math textbook!). Lucy's not sure what a girl who does calculus homework for fun can possibly learn in 7th grade. She has everything she needs at home, where nobody can make fun of her rigid routines or her superpowered brain. The equation of Lucy's life has already been solved. Unless there's been a miscalculation?
A celebration of friendship, Stacy McAnulty's smart and thoughtful middle-grade debut reminds us all to get out of our comfort zones and embrace what makes us different.

Publisher's Weekly
Starred review from April 2, 2018
When 12-year-old Lucy was struck by lightning at age eight, her brain was damaged, resulting in her acquired savant syndrome. She becomes a mathematical genius and develops obsessive-compulsive disorder; she’s been homeschooled ever since. She feels safe at home with her uncle and grandmother, but Nana wants Lucy to become better integrated with her peers and enrolls her in seventh grade. Lucy hides her math abilities to blend in, and she’s bullied by popular girl Maddie, but when she and another student, Windy, team up with classmate Levi for a community service project, a true friendship grows. The three help out at the Pet Hut, a no-kill shelter where Lucy, who has never liked animals, bonds with Cutie Pi. After Cutie Pi is diagnosed with cancer—which means that she will likely be transferred to a state shelter and put down—and Windy betrays Lucy by revealing a secret, Lucy must learn how to solve problems of the heart. McAnulty realistically portrays Lucy’s OCD, and her struggles in middle school also ring true. Every character is fully formed, and Lucy’s journey is beautifully authentic in this debut brimming with warmth, wisdom, and math. Ages 8–12. Agent: Lori Kilkelly, Rodeen Literary Management. -
AudioFile Magazine
Ana Isabel's youthful narration creates a convincing picture of innocent 12-year-old Lucy. At 8, Lucy was struck by lightning and transformed into a math genius and germaphobe, but she's far from gifted in the ways of friendship. Aside from her uncle and grandmother, she prefers virtual relationships. Narrator Isabel affects an older, caring voice for Nana, who has raised and homeschooled Lucy since her parents' deaths. Now Nana requires Lucy to attend one year of middle school, make real friends, and get involved. Lucy's story develops primarily through scenes of her experiences at school: her OCD behavior, her friendship with two girls who overlook it, and the painful bullying by a cruel peer who doesn't. Listeners hear a tender tone when a situation involving an orphaned dog requires that Lucy overcome her emotional problems. S.W. © AudioFile 2018, Portland, Maine
